"Michael R. Wolf" <address@hidden> writes:
> I've just gotten gnus to work enough that I'm ready to make a
> migration. Pointers please for the following information.
>
> -- message migration
Configure the Exchange server to allow IMAP.
this will give you
> automated pull in gnus
using the nnimap backend.
Alternatively POP3 can be used by both Outlook Express and Gnus, but
you then lose co-existance.
> -- address book migration
If it is a server based address book, enable LDAP on the server, and
use eudc in Emacs (comes with Emacs as of 21.1). Otherwise use BBDB in
Emacs (bbdb.sourceforge.net), but I am not sure if you can import from
Outlook yet (there is an export filter for outlook format included
BBDB 2.32 though).
> -- ongoing co-existance (pipe dream)
Not a problem for messages if you use IMAP, or for addresses if you
use LDAP, since in those cases everything is stored on the server.
